My spouse and I will be traveling on the Noordam on March 10th and we were happy to hear about how good the cruise went for you.

Would like to know when the formal nights are. I tried to get the information from the personnel at HAL but they said it was up to the captain as to when the formal nights would be.

I would appreciate your help with this.

 

Someone reported recently that either their 10 or 11 day Noordam cruise -- which was scheduled to have 3 formal nights -- was changed to 2 formal nights.

So you may not know until you are on the ship and actually read your "On Location" program or the "Explore" for your cruise how many formal nights you will have and when they will be.

I was on the Noordam last month and found the ship to be in great condition. Our cabin was a little dated but condition was fine. A few toilet flushing issues occurred but were soon fixed.

 

All the public areas were in good order and maintenance seemed to be constantly ongoing. I even saw the ceilings being scrubbed at one point.....

I too am recently off the Noordam (dec 16 thru 30). I have to say we smelled the sewage smell in various places thought the ship. It was very localized though. We often noticed it on our deck (deck 4) walking to our cabin from midship to aft. We were in a VD balcony (4163). I do not know if people smelled it in their rooms but we definitely smelled it on a regular basis in the hallway by those rooms. Once you made it past the aft elevators it went away. It didn't smell in the hallway outside of our room or in our room but I can see how people experienced this in the rooms and others did not. Also a few times while in port we smelled it while in the sea view pool (also midship).

We just got off the Noordam this morning and don't really have any major complaints. I guess if your looking for some peeling wall paper or scratched surfaces you would notice it but I didn't at first until we were joking about some of the complaints I had read of the ship and how minor they seemed to us. As was already mentioned, shabby is a subjective term.

 

We didn't have any flushing problems although I did hear two people say they had issues a couple times, although they were resolved later in the day. Our cabin temperature was perfect for me, Fiancee was pretty cold at night but that's normal.

 

We are pretty young compared to the average age on the cruise (mid 20's) and really had a great time. Loved Mario, the Cruise Director. Benji, the comedian/juggler mentioned Mario being in the top 4 for a best cruise director award across all cruise companies. I don't know if that was true or not but I wouldn't be surprised, although the fact he's only been doing it for 3 months was surprising. Loved the BB King Allstars. If anyones cruising when they are on board I would certainly recommend seeing them. We went every night for as many show times as we could and loved every second of it. Game shows were all hilarious mainly due to Mario and Jeremy (Game show host).

 

Can't really comment on the food as it was much fancier then what we usually eat at home as were always on the go. It was always warm and cooked the way we ordered it. Honestly didn't notice much of a difference in the food quality between the Pinnacle and MDR, but again, that may just be my lack of gourmet dining. Had a laugh when I ordered the 'Steak tartare' appetizer in the Pinnacle and was served 3 sliced tomatoes with a balsamic dressing. Overall I'd say the food was very good, to me anyways.

 

We did Luggage direct and would do it again everytime from here on out. Even if our flight was earlier (5pm today) I'd do it just to skip the checked bags line up at the airport. Disembarkation was pretty quick as we got off at 730am, probably took about 20 mins from when we left our room. Embarkation on the other hand was pretty slow compared to what I've read here. Arrived at 11:30 and checked in by 12pm. They had just started boarding guests with tags numbered #1 when we got through and we had #29.

 

Only thing I would complain about if I had to was the in room breakfast wasn't correct many times. We always ordered a coffee and tea and a couple times only got one. Or didn't receive any condiments. I suppose we should have checked it over when they delivered but either way whether we told them at the time or called down, it took a while to receive the rest of our order. Also took a long time for them to remove old trays. Didn't bother me much aside from the one day when we had 2 trays in our room until 3 pm.
